eMusic is a subscription-based online music store. In addition to supporting independent artists and record labels, eMusic is known for selling DRM-free MP3s which are compatible with all current portable media players.
-
Fast Facts
- Founded in 1998 as "GoodNoise"
- Founders: Gene Hoffman and Bob Kohn
- First company to sell music in MP3 formateMusic: http://www.emusic.com/about... About eMusic]
- Renamed eMusic in 1999
- Tracks available: More than 3.5 millioneMusic Press Room: eMUSIC KEEPS ON GROWING - WORLD'S LARGEST INDIE CATALOGUE NOW AT 3.5 MILLION TRACKS (March 10, 2008)
- Second largest seller of online digital music next to the iTunes StoreeMusic Press Room: eMUSIC KEEPS ON GROWING - WORLD'S LARGEST INDIE CATALOGUE NOW AT 3.5 MILLION TRACKS (March 10, 2008)
- Uses a monthly-subscription system rather than selling songs individually
- Total subscribers: More than 300,000eMusic Press Room: EMUSIC MOMENTUM CONTINUES; TOPS 300,000 SUBSCRIBERS (April 17, 2007)
- Offers a trial period that gives prospective users 25 free downloads
- Sells MP3s without DRM protection
- Also sell audiobookseMusic: http://www.emusic.com/about... About eMusic]

Subscription Plans
eMusic used to offer subscribers an unlimited number of downloads per month. When they changed their subscription policies in November, 2003, many users were opposed.MetaFilter: eMusic Ends Unlimited Service (October 9, 2003) Currently, eMusic offers three monthly subscription plans:- eMusic Basic
- 30 downloads
- $11.99
- eMusic Plus
- 50 downloads
- $14.99
